Day-to-day activities will include…

Delivering the best possible service for our clients is everyone’s job – not just the role of our team members working on a client site. From creating innovative technological solutions to bringing together the right people and capabilities in diverse teams, the opportunities to develop your career behind the scenes here, working within an inclusive culture, are both huge and diverse. 

Working closely with stakeholders in our Consulting business to define and clearly articulate a product concept: what problem will it solve, and how?

  • Engaging and collaborating with potential clients to understand their challenges and expectations

  • Evaluating the market: who are our potential competitors or partners, and what is our best strategic approach?

  • Collaborating with technical teams to understand the feasibility of the proposed venture and the resources required to develop it

  • Assembling the commercial case for the venture, advise the business on the best investment decision and pitch for funding from budget holders

  • Developing the minimum viable product to test market response

  • Formulating hypotheses about the best course of action at each stage, and validating these by gathering data and information from a wide variety of sources

  • Refining the product concept in line with lean-startup principles
